Frequently Asked Questions

What Is ASA Filament?

ASA (acrylonitrile styrene acrylate) is an engineering thermoplastic developed as a UV-resistant upgrade to ABS. It matches ABS on strength and impact resistance while adding excellent resistance to sunlight, weather, and moisture, making it the go-to filament for parts that live outdoors.

What Temperature Should I Print ASA At?

Most ASA prints between 240–260°C on the nozzle, with a bed temperature of 90–110°C. Exact settings vary by brand and colour, so always check the specific product listing for the manufacturer’s recommended profile.

What’s The Difference Between ASA And ABS?

ASA and ABS share similar strength and impact resistance, but ASA is engineered specifically for UV resistance — it won’t yellow or turn brittle in sunlight the way ABS does. ASA is also slightly more dimensionally stable and warps a little less, though it typically costs more and, unlike ABS, can’t be smoothed with acetone vapour.

Can ASA Be Used Outdoors?

Yes, ASA is one of the best filaments for outdoor use. It resists fading, cracking, and brittleness from prolonged UV and weather exposure far better than ABS or PETG, making it a strong choice for garden fixtures, automotive parts, and anything left in the sun long-term.

Do I Need An Enclosure To Print ASA?

An enclosure is strongly recommended. Like ABS, ASA needs a stable, warm ambient temperature (around 45–60°C) to prevent warping and layer delamination, though ASA is somewhat more forgiving than ABS once your settings are dialled in.

What Bed Surface Works Best For ASA?

PEI sheets give reliable adhesion and release cleanly once cool. A glue stick layer, hairspray, or an ASA/ABS slurry on glass are also common adhesion aids, along with a wide brim to help anchor larger parts against warping.

Should I Use A Part Cooling Fan With ASA?

Keep cooling low, generally 0–30%. ASA relies on staying warm for good layer bonding and dimensional stability, so heavy part cooling increases the risk of warping and weak interlayer adhesion.

Is ASA Safe To Print Indoors?

ASA emits fumes similar to ABS during printing, so good ventilation or a filtered enclosure is recommended, particularly for longer prints or shared indoor spaces.
